Comelec keeps options open to new poll system

THE Commission on Elections (Comelec) is keeping its options open on the possibility of using a semi-automated election system amid uncertainties on the availability of the controversial Precinct Count Optical Scan (PCOS) machines for the 2016 elections.

The use of the PCOS machines was the subject of a temporary restraining order (TRO) issued recently by the Supreme Court (SC).
